Modern preppy is the theme of this season’s UNIQLO and JW ANDERSON collection. Originating in the fashion trends of 1980s prep schools in the Northeastern US, the style’s perhaps best described as a casual update to trad.

The key here is understanding what “casual” entails. Drawing examples from the preceding pages, here’s some rules and ideas on how to use the style.Link toGood Morning, New York City

1.Clean and Neat

A preppy haircut is consummately tidy, as a point of contrast to the casual elements of the style.

2.Turn it Up!

Polo shirts, a must-have, work equally well on their own or layered with an Oxford shirt or jacket. Popping the collar gives the outfit extra dimensionality.

3.Iconic Navy

Navy blazers with metal buttons never go out of style. During spring and summer, dress on the sporty side. The ultra light blazer on the page is just right for keeping cool in warmer weather.

4.It’s ALL in the Wrist

Opt for classic timepieces. Trade the standard wristband for a colorful design.

5.Sporty Vibe

Athletics that sharpen the mind and body are a key component of the preppy style. Striped rugby shirts and tennis-inspired polos are essential. Long sleeve items can be draped over the shoulders or tied around the waist.

6.The Baggy Straight

Instead of slacks, style your blazer with a pair of chinos. Go with a looser silhouette and slightly messy cuffs. Just high enough to show the ankles. Or mix it up with a green pair of cargo pants.

7.Classic Shoes

Though wearing shoes without socks may have started as a “lazy” style on Ivy League campuses, it looks sharp to this day. Penny loafers and boat shoes are good options here.

1.Authentic Glasses

For celluloid frames, go with Wellington or Boston styles in black, tortoiseshell or brown. Authentic metal frames are also great. Find a new favorite in the feature.

2.How to Roll?

Sleeves can be rolled however you like, just keep the look a little rough. We recommend a cuff-like roll. First unbutton the sleeve and do a big fold. Then roll again from the bottom edge. Stop before the elbow for the right balance.

3.Loose Knots

Regimental ties are another wardrobe must. For a casual style, keep the knot small and on the looser side. It’s okay to unbutton the collar.

4.Oxford Forever

Oxford shirts, a UNIQLO staple, are a classic choice. Don’t miss the new women’s shirt in a boxy silhouette on the page. You can skip the ironing; a well-laundered look is key.

5.Cool Seersucker

Seersucker is practically synonymous with preppy. The crinkled surface keeps you cool, and because of the material’s trad roots, it looks classy even in a pair of easy shorts.

1.Over the Shoulders

Draping a layer over the shoulders is a simple way to change an outfit instantly. Whether it’s a sweater or a shirt, fold down the collar first, for a nice clean drape.

2.Small Embroidery

Monograms are a very preppy touch. Traditionally embroidered at the waist or cuffs. Visit RE.UNIQLO STUDIO for custom services.

3.Canvas Tote

Lightweight totes are great, but a heavy-duty canvas tote gives your outfit an American feel without looking too conservative.

Over the past ten years, health consciousness has become the norm. Following this trend, functional and light athleisure wear has grown in popularity for its casual approach to sporty styles. As we’ve seen, Copenhagen is a place where sports are part of life, leading to functional and modern streetwear.

Walk the streets, and you’ll see sports blend seamlessly into the everyday, with bicycles weaving through crowds and runners jogging along the canals. As lifestyles change, sportswear has evolved to include items like bra tops and jogger pants. Touching upon three styles seen in the Copenhagen feature, let’s take a closer look at the Nordic world’s refined approach to activewear.Link toSporty & Chic from Copenhagen

1.Shirts as a Midlayer

Try wearing a sporty top and bottom with a comfy striped Oxford shirt. The playful layering found in streetwear softens out the edges.

2.Cropped Innerwear

This sporty midriff T-shirt has a flattering pattern and relaxed feel great for spring and summer. The considerable difference between lengths gives the layers added volume.

3.Tone on Tone

Wearing a few select colors gives an outfit minimalist grace. Combining matching tones like on the page creates a fresh and modern look.

4.Wide Silhouette

Taking cues from outdoor fashion, these geared pants have quick-drying functionality and UV blocking properties, making them great daily wear. The light and roomy fit matches the vibe of spring and summer.

5.Tuck Up the Hem!

Showing the ankles is a quick way to make an outfit sporty. Cinch up those drawstrings to show your socks and sneakers, keeping the ankles tidy.
